The attached patch allows a VDR system with multiple cards to attach each card to an individual dish pointing at a different satellite.
I have 3 DVB cards in my VDR system:
1) FF card connected to one output of LNB at a dish pointed at Astra 19.2E.
2) budget card connected to another output of LNB at a dish pointed at Astra 19.2E.
3) budget card connected to output of LNB at a dish pointed at Eutelsat 13.0E.
I am using the following entries for that in my setup.conf:
SourceCaps = 1 S19.2E SourceCaps = 2 S19.2E SourceCaps = 3 S13.0E

Hello,
I have 2 DVB cards in my VDR system
1) FF card for Astra 19.2E and Eutelsat 13.0E.
2) budget card for Astra 19.2E
I am using the following entries for that in my setup.conf:
SourceCaps = 1 S19.2E S13.0E SourceCaps = 2 S19.2E
With vdr 1.3.22 - included patch for vdr 1.3.18 - sourcecaps-patch works fine (only the automatic scan for new channels produced mistakes).
Now i have tested this patch with vdr 1.3.34, but the first entry of SourceCaps in setup.conf will be ignored and is deleted after shutdown vdr.

Hi!
I had the same problem and now found out that old sourcecaps patches changed cSource::fromString with attached patch, which is missing in newest sourcecaps-patch. With it applied everything works as expected.

I had the same problem and now found out that old sourcecaps patches changed cSource::fromString with attached patch, which is missing in newest sourcecaps-patch. With it applied everything works as expected.
Thanks for the info. For my setup (one sat per card) that code was not needed and I also have doubts that it should go into a global function. But apparaently it was not OK to remove it. I will fix this with the 1.3.35 version of the patch.
